What is Craigslist Detroit?

Craigslist Detroit is a localized version of the popular online classifieds website, Craigslist. It serves as a community bulletin board where people can buy, sell, trade, and connect with others in the Detroit metropolitan area. Think of it as a digital town square where you can find everything from housing and jobs to services and personal connections. Unlike more curated platforms, Craigslist prides itself on being a no-frills, straightforward, and largely unmoderated space. This means it's incredibly diverse but also requires a bit of savvy to navigate safely.

Safety Tips for Using Craigslist Detroit

  1. Meet in a Public Place: Always meet sellers or buyers in a well-lit, public location. Think coffee shops, shopping centers, or even the local police station. Avoid meeting at private residences or secluded areas.
  2. Bring a Friend: There's safety in numbers! Bring a friend or family member with you when meeting someone from Craigslist. They can provide an extra set of eyes and ears, and it's just good to have backup.
  3. Trust Your Gut: If something feels off, don't ignore it. If the person is evasive, pushy, or makes you uncomfortable, walk away. It's better to be safe than sorry.
  4. Never Send Money in Advance: This is a big one! Never wire money, send gift cards, or use any other form of non-refundable payment before meeting the seller and inspecting the item. Scammers love to target unsuspecting buyers with these tactics.
  5. Inspect Items Carefully: When buying something, take your time to inspect it thoroughly. Check for any defects, damage, or signs of wear and tear. Ask questions and don't be afraid to negotiate the price if necessary.
